Chroniken von Bangkok
Bangkok was founded in 1782 as Rattanakosin, a planned capital on the east bank of the Chao Phraya, after the fall of Ayutthaya. Its core was a grid of canals earning the nickname 'Venice of the East', with Grand Palace and Wat Phra Kaew as centrepieces. The 20th-century canal infill for roads and a late-1990s skytrain system transformed it into a sprawling, modern metropolis. Today, Bangkok is a city of jarring contrasts — gleaming malls beside wooden shophouses, saffron robes amid neon signs — whose hybrid identity of monarchy, Buddhism and consumerism remains unique in Southeast Asia.

Geld & Währung
Get a travel card →Thai Baht (THB)
Exchange money at a local bank or a licensed money changer for a better rate; avoid airport currency exchange offices for poor rates. Bring a mix of cash and cards for flexibility.
Credit and debit cards are widely accepted in Bangkok, especially at mid-range and high-end establishments; contactless payments are common, and mobile payments like GrabPay and True Money Wallet are also widely accepted.
Tipping is not expected but appreciated; round up the bill to the nearest 10 THB or leave 20-50 THB for good service at restaurants; 20-50 THB for taxi drivers; 50-100 THB for hotel staff.
Essen, Einkaufen und Reisen auf einem Budget
Cheap car hire →Try a typical street coffee from a local vendor for around 20-30 THB per cup.
Eat at a street food stall or a local market, where a meal costs around 100-150 THB.
A bowl of boat noodles or a simple meal at a local restaurant will cost around 150-250 THB.
Try the night markets like Rot Fai or Patpong for a variety of street food options.
7-Eleven, Family Mart, and Tesco Lotus are common grocery stores in this area.
Visit the Chatuchak Weekend Market for affordable high-street and market shopping.
The BTS skytrain and MRT subway are the cheapest ways to get around Bangkok; a single ride costs 16 THB; buy a day pass for 140 THB to save money.
Avoid eating at touristy areas for inflated prices; opt for local eateries or street food stalls.Use the BTS or MRT instead of taxis for shorter distances to save money.Shop at local markets or street vendors for authentic and affordable goods.
